Discover The Considerable Internet Providers Handbook For A Comprehensive Introduction To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ions
Discover The Considerable Internet Providers Handbook For A Comprehensive Introduction To Interaction Protocols-Your Trick To Opening The Globe Of Web Solutions
Blog Article
Short Article By-Kaae Alvarez
Discover the supreme Internet Services Manual for all your needs. Check out interaction protocols, core principles of SOAP and remainder, and finest methods for seamless execution. Discover the secrets to mastering internet services, from comprehending the essentials to carrying out scalable design. Master the art of making safe systems and enhancing for future development. Unlock the power of web solutions at your fingertips.
Review of Web Providers
If you have actually ever questioned what internet services are and exactly how they work, this review is the best place to start. Web services are a method for various applications to connect with each other online. They enable smooth combination of systems, making it simpler to share information and capabilities.
One of the essential facets of internet services is their use typical procedures like HTTP and XML to promote interaction. This standardization makes sure that different systems can recognize and engage with each other efficiently. Web services can be categorized right into 2 primary types: SOAP (Simple Item Gain Access To Protocol) and Remainder (Representational State Transfer).
SOAP is a protocol that makes use of XML for message exchange, while REST relies upon basic HTTP techniques like obtain, UPLOAD, PUT, and remove. Both have their staminas and are used in numerous situations based upon requirements.
Key Concepts and Technologies
Exploring the foundational ideas and innovations of internet services is important for recognizing their performance and application in contemporary systems. When delving into relevant site and technologies of web services, you open the door to a world of interconnected possibilities. Here are some essential elements to comprehend:
- ** SOAP (Simple Object Gain Access To Protocol) **: This procedure defines the structure of messages exchanged between internet solutions.
- ** WSDL (Internet Services Summary Language) **: WSDL is used to describe the capabilities supplied by a web service.
- ** REST (Representational State Transfer) **: A building design that makes use of standard HTTP techniques for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ange in between web solutions because of its versatility and readability.
Recognizing these core principles and modern technologies will lay a solid foundation for your trip into the realm of internet solutions.
Best Practices for Application
To guarantee successful execution of web services, focus on adherence to finest methods. Begin by thoroughly recording your internet solution APIs, consisting of clear descriptions of endpoints, parameters, and anticipated reactions. Consistent naming conventions and versioning of APIs are critical for maintainability. When creating your web services, adhere to the principles of remainder to create a scalable and adaptable architecture. Execute proper verification and authorization devices to safeguard your services, such as OAuth or API keys.
Testing is vital in making sure the dependability of your internet services. Establish comprehensive test cases that cover numerous scenarios, including positive and adverse screening. Continuous assimilation and automated testing can assist capture problems early in the development process. link web site in real-time to determine performance bottlenecks and prospective failures. Logging and error handling are crucial for detecting concerns and troubleshooting problems properly.
Last but not least, consider the scalability of your web solutions deliberately for future growth. Implement caching systems and load balancing to handle increased website traffic. Consistently testimonial and optimize your code for efficiency. By complying with https://zaneaunfy.izrablog.com/30408201/differentiating-the-contrasts-between-local-seo-and-conventional-search-engine-optimization , you can improve the execution of internet services and ensure their success.
Final thought
Congratulations! https://how-to-do-seo49382.thelateblog.com/30385040/discover-the-art-of-crafting-headings-that-jail-interest-and-ctas-that-encourage-leading-the-way-for-an-effective-ppc-project have actually just opened the trick to understanding internet services. By comprehending the key ideas and technologies, and executing best methods, you're well on your way to coming to be a web services expert.
Maintain discovering and trying out what you've learned to proceed expanding your expertise and skills in this amazing area.
The world of web solutions is currently at your fingertips, ready for you to discover and conquer. Appreciate the journey!